1. Location
The first thing to consider when planning on buying an apartment in Sydney is the location. There are so many different things that you want your new apartments located near – such as work, shops, and entertainment areas. For example, if you love nightlife then it might be a good idea for you to buy apartment Sydney in Surry Hills or Newtown because these suburbs have great bars and restaurants where everyone goes out at night (and there’s also public transport nearby). If it’s important for your job to live close by, make sure that this fact is taken into account during the purchase process! It will save you from commuting every day if it turns out living next door isn’t possible.
On top of having locations like cafes and local attractions nearby (which many apartments in Sydney will have), it’s also important to make sure that your apartment is close by facilities such as hospitals and schools.
To sum up, before buying an apartment you should think about which area of Sydney would be best for what matters most to you and then narrow down the choices from there (so this might mean getting more than one opinion). 4. Pets
It’s definitely important to consider whether you’re allowed to have pets when buying an apartment – and also what kind of animals will be accepted. This is something that could change depending on the type of apartment in Sydney but it’s worth knowing if your lifestyle potentially includes any furry friends before taking a look around!
Many people might not realise this however there are many apartments that don’t allow all types of animals so make sure you know beforehand if having pets will be an issue or not (especially for bigger ones such as dogs). If they do then looking at other places may well save yourself from being locked out later down the line although some buildings can let owners register their dog with them, making it easier for everyone involved.
